How they compare
Slovenia currently reports 109,920 against 63,141 in Northern Africa: Upper-middle income, a difference of 46,779.
That makes Slovenia's figure about 1.7 times Northern Africa: Upper-middle income's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 37 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Northern Africa: Upper-middle income ahead.
Northern Africa: Upper-middle income ranks 33rd and Slovenia ranks 36th of 87 groups.
Across the 4 decades both report, Northern Africa: Upper-middle income averaged higher in 1 and Slovenia in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Northern Africa: Upper-middle income | Slovenia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 57,634 | 56,755 | 879.46 | Northern Africa: Upper-middle income |
| 2000s | 56,450 | 74,470 | 18,019 | Slovenia |
| 2010s | 55,569 | 86,580 | 31,011 | Slovenia |
| 2020s | 59,731 | 101,200 | 41,469 | Slovenia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
This measure of labour productivity is calculated using data on GDP (in constant 2021 international dollars at PPP) derived from the World Development Indicators database of the World Bank. To compute labour productivity as GDP per worker, ILO estimates for total employment are used. For more information, refer to the ILO Modelled Estimates (ILOEST) database description.
